“…Analysis of the amino acid sequence of the RC-protein, and that of the enzymatically or chemically digested fragments, was performed with an Applied Biosystems model Procise f gas-liquid protein sequencer® (USA). The phenylthiohydantoin (PTH) derivatives of the amino acids were identified with an Applied Biosystems model 450 microgradient PTH-analyser® (USA) (22,23). The resulting primary structure of BmLec was aligned with homologous sequences obtained from the NCBI database (http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ov) using the algorithm BLAST.…”

“…Some purified Bothrops toxins are able to reproduce the renal effects obtained with whole venom. Studies on the isolated perfused rat kidney have shown that L-amino acid oxidase (Braga et al, 2008), C-type lectins (Braga et al, 2006), phospholipase A2 myotoxins (Barbosa et al, 2005;Evangelista et al, 2010) and thrombin-like enzyme (Braga et al, 2007) from Bothrops venoms can alter renal function. The isolated perfused kidney technique also confirmed the direct acute tubular nephrotoxicity of Bothrops venoms and showed that platelet activating factor might play a role in some renal functional disturbances such as the decreased in glomerular filtration rate (Monteiro and Fonteles, 1999).…”
